MySQL:如何使用创建用户命令(mysql创建用户命令)

MySQL是一种流行的关系型数据库管理系统,使用非常广泛。为了保障MySQL服务器的安全,需要定期创建新用户或者为现有用户分配权限。这里我们介绍创建用户的一般步骤,以及MySQL控制台如何使用命令创建新用户的实例。

首先,您需要使用拥有root权限的用户登录MySQL服务器,然后您可以使用以下命令来创建一个新的MySQL用户:

CREATE USER 'username'@'localhost' IDENTIFIED BY 'password';

这行命令使用以下参数创建新用户:

– 用户名称: ‘username’

– 来源主机: ‘localhost’

– 登录密码: ‘password’

有时候您需要为用户指定更多属性,例如用户类型或限制登录时间,您可以使用以下语句来指定:

CREATE USER 'username'@'localhost' IDENTIFIED BY 'password'
WITH MAX_QUERIES_PER_HOUR 20 MAX_UPDATES_PER_HOUR 10;

此外,您还可以为新创建的用户授予权限,例如让用户可以访问某个数据库:

GRANT ALL PRIVILEGES ON database_name.* TO 'username'@'localhost';

最后,让MySQL服务器立即使用新修改的权限:

FLUSH PRIVILEGES;

以上就是利用MySQL命令创建新用户的一般步骤。如果您想要在某些特定的数据库上为用户授予权限的话,可以使用以下GRANT命令。您也可以使用MySQL的GRANT 命令进一步指定新用户能够连接到MySQL服务器的网络位置等。

希望本文对你有所帮助,让你更加轻松的创建MySQL用户!


数据运维技术 » MySQL:如何使用创建用户命令(mysql创建用户命令)